Pla Jian (Fried Fish with Three-Flavored Sauce)
Crispy on the outside, tender on the inside fried fish topped with a savory, sweet, and slightly sour sauce.
Steps
- 1
Fry the fish in hot oil over medium heat until cooked through. Set aside.
- 2
Coarsely chop the garlic, cut the green onions and cilantro into sections, and julienne the ginger. Set aside.
- 3
Heat a pan and add vegetable oil. Once hot, add the garlic and fry until golden. Add the fermented soybean paste and ginger, stir-frying until fragrant.
- 4
Add water and season with soy sauce, oyster sauce, tamarind juice, and coconut sugar. Taste and adjust seasoning. Add the green onions and cilantro, stir quickly 2-3 times, then turn off the heat.
